Hans Kumpf (born June 8, 1951 in Stuttgart ) is a German jazz clarinetist , author and photographer.

After graduating from high school, Kumpf first studied with Helmut Lachenmann at the Ludwigsburg University of Education and attended the international courses for new music in Darmstadt ; He also completed jazz courses in Remscheid , with Erwin Lehn , Albert Mangelsdorff and Johnny Griffin . In 1972 he presented himself with the group AK Musick at the German Jazz Festival in Frankfurt . In 1975 Wolfgang Dauner brought him to a production of the Radio Jazz Group Stuttgart, which he directed, with Louis Moholo and Irène Schweizer ; In 1976 he released a duo record with Perry Robinson and played with Theo Jörgensmann's Clarinet Contrast project . Then he played with John Fischer in Moscow, Zurich and Le Mans. In 1979 he performed in New York City with Perry Robinson. Since 1980 he has repeatedly visited Russia, where he worked with avant-garde musicians. He also worked with Harry Tavitian and Jürg Solothurnmann . In 1990 he was in Indonesia with the Baden-Württemberg Youth Jazz Orchestra .

In addition to solo appearances, he works with bassists Jan Jankeje and Vitold Rek . With his wife Katarzyna Kumpf he also organizes jazz and poetry concerts with Polish poetry.

In a book published in 1976, Kumpf analyzed the relationship between post-serial music and free jazz (2nd edition 1981) and also published several status analyzes in jazz research . He writes regularly for magazines such as the Jazz Podium and has also emerged as a jazz photographer.
